Mukul Choudhary's Stunning Innings Secures LSG Victory in IPL Thriller

In a breathtaking display of power-hitting and composure, young wicketkeeper-batter Mukul Choudhary announced his arrival on the Indian Premier League stage with a match-winning performance. The 21-year-old's unbeaten 54 off just 27 balls, featuring seven sixes and two fours, propelled Lucknow Super Giants to a thrilling three-wicket victory over Kolkata Knight Riders at a packed Eden Gardens on Thursday.

Coach Justin Langer Hails Choudhary's Talent and Intelligence

LSG head coach Justin Langer was effusive in his praise for the young star, highlighting his athleticism and cricketing brain. "We have had some practice games, and the way he talks about the game is like he has been playing 300 matches," Langer remarked in an interview. "He is a great athlete with a sharp and curious mind. He went away and worked on the short ball, and it showed in practice and the game." Langer even drew a comparison to Indian batting legend Virat Kohli, noting Choudhary's exceptional running between the wickets.

Analyst's Insight Key to Choudhary's Recruitment

Langer revealed that team analyst Shrinivas Chandrashekaran played a pivotal role in bringing Choudhary into the LSG setup. "We saw him at a training camp a few months ago. A real big shout-out goes to Shrinivas, our data analyst, who said, 'Coach, we have got to get this kid,'" Langer explained. This underscores the growing importance of data-driven decisions in modern cricket, especially in talent scouting for high-stakes tournaments like the IPL.

Critical Moments and Team Morale Boost

When LSG needed 54 runs off the final 24 balls, Langer admitted to focusing on post-match reflections rather than the pressure of the chase. "I was probably thinking about what I was going to say to our players. I thought we bowled brilliantly on this wicket; we were outstanding," he said. Despite the tense situation, Langer emphasized the team's excellent bowling and elite fielding, which set the stage for Choudhary's heroics.

Langer believes that such close victories early in the tournament serve as a magic tonic for team morale. "If you win the close ones, you get that little bit of belief. These tight wins are like a confidence booster at the start of the season, and we have a lot of upside left in our game," he added. This win not only gave LSG their second victory of the season but also thrust Choudhary into the spotlight, marking him as a player to watch in future matches.
